Southern Caramel Pound Cake

Step 1: Cream the butter, shortening & sugar
Mix until light and fluffy to create the perfect pound cake foundation.

Step 2: Add the eggs
Add eggs one at a time to ensure a smooth and rich batter.

Step 3: Combine the dry ingredients
Whisk flour, baking powder, and salt in a separate bowl.

Step 4: Add dry ingredients alternately with milk
Alternate flour mixture and milk into the batter, ending with flour. Add vanilla.

Step 5: Bake the cake
Pour into a greased Bundt pan and bake at 325°F (163°C) for 75–90 minutes. Cool completely.

Step 6: Make the caramel icing
Melt butter, add brown sugar, and cook gently until melted. Add milk, boil 2 minutes, remove from heat. Whisk in powdered sugar and vanilla until smooth.

Step 7: Glaze the cake
Pour warm caramel icing over the cake so it sinks perfectly into every groove.
